The purple robe worn by ancient Chinese women is a type of traditional attire that symbolizes nobility, elegance, and mystery.
This garment is typically made from silk, featuring bright and luxurious colors, intricate designs, and unique patterns.
In ancient China, purple was considered the color of the royal family, and only members of the imperial household and aristocrats were allowed to wear purple clothing.
Therefore, women who wore purple robes were often daughters of royalty or noble families.
This attire not only made a striking impression on the wearer's appearance but also held significant cultural and historical significance.
It was an integral part of ancient Chinese culture, reflecting the social status and values of that time.
By studying the purple robes worn by ancient Chinese women, we can gain a better understanding of the country's rich history and culture.
